Solution for 4x-27=7x+45 equation:


Simplifying
4x + -27 = 7x + 45

Reorder the terms:
-27 + 4x = 7x + 45

Reorder the terms:
-27 + 4x = 45 + 7x

Solving
-27 + 4x = 45 + 7x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7x' to each side of the equation.
-27 + 4x + -7x = 45 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 4x + -7x = -3x
-27 + -3x = 45 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 7x + -7x = 0
-27 + -3x = 45 + 0
-27 + -3x = 45

Add '27' to each side of the equation.
-27 + 27 + -3x = 45 + 27

Combine like terms: -27 + 27 = 0
0 + -3x = 45 + 27
-3x = 45 + 27

Combine like terms: 45 + 27 = 72
-3x = 72

Divide each side by '-3'.
x = -24

Simplifying
x = -24
